Explorar o código

:art: 改进提及和虚拟引用搜索分词 Fix https://github.com/siyuan-note/siyuan/issues/6165

Liang Ding %!s(int64=2) %!d(string=hai) anos
pai
achega
4a336e7430
Modificáronse 1 ficheiros con 1 adicións e 1 borrados
  1. 1 1
      kernel/model/file.go

+ 1 - 1
kernel/model/file.go

@@ -693,7 +693,7 @@ func GetDoc(startID, endID, id string, index int, keyword string, mode int, size
 								blockKeys = append(blockKeys, alias)
 							}
 							if 0 < len(blockKeys) {
-								keys := gulu.Str.SubstringsBetween(newContent, "<span data-type=\"virtual-block-ref\">", "</span>")
+								keys := gulu.Str.SubstringsBetween(newContent, virtualBlockRefSpanStart, virtualBlockRefSpanEnd)
 								for _, k := range keys {
 									if gulu.Str.Contains(k, blockKeys) {
 										return ast.WalkContinue